Overview

Fairholmes -  Abbey Tip Plantation - Abbey Brook - Cartledge Stones Ridge - Back Tor - Derwent Edge - Wheel Stones - Whinstone Lee Tor - Grindle Clough - Fairholmes

Start and finish on the reservoir access track/road then on decent paths for most of the route with some flagged sections on the higher stretchers of the ridge/moor. There are a number of uphill sections following the course of Abbey Brook and care is needed near the top as we climb up from Sheepfold Clough.
